Popular Styles of Epoxy Resin Art
The following styles of epoxy resin art are popular in Nigeria:
- Fluid Art and Abstract Paintings: Known for their dynamic movement and visual impact, often enhanced with pigment ink.
- Resin Tables and Furniture: Particularly "river tables" that combine resin with wood, creating a natural and modern aesthetic.
- Jewelry and Accessories: Epoxy resin's smooth surface and moldability make it ideal for creating unique jewelry and accessories, sometimes incorporating gold foil for a luxurious touch.
- Sculptures and Three-Dimensional Art: Valued for their three-dimensional presence and artistic expression, often using silicone molds for detailed shapes.
- Encapsulating Natural Elements and Specimens: Dried flowers are popularly used to create unique natural beauty in epoxy resin art.
- 3D Art with Depth and Layering: Admired for their sense of depth and visual hierarchy, achieved through the layering of resin filling materials.
